Plugin SDK Capabilities
@jshookmcp/extension-sdk/plugin Export Hierarchy
Interfaces and Structural Types
ToolProfileIdToolArgsToolResponsePluginStatePluginLifecycleContextExtensionToolHandlerExtensionToolDefinitionExtensionBuilder
Actionable Top-Level Generators (1)
| Functional Signature | Minimal Integration Syntax | Architectural Purpose |
|---|---|---|
createExtension(id, version) | createExtension('example.demo', '1.0.0') | Synthesizes a fluent declarative build channel |
PluginLifecycleContext Injected Execution Vectors (6)
These methods operate exclusively within the sandbox closure instantiated during lifecycle hooks.
| Execution Vector | Implementation Signature | Contract Adherence |
|---|---|---|
registerMetric(metricName) | ctx.registerMetric('demo.requests') | Maps bounded metrics for observability |
invokeTool(name, args?) | await ctx.invokeTool('page_navigate', { url: 'https://example.com' }) | Initiates verified Subsystem RPC calls |
hasPermission(capability) | ctx.hasPermission('toolExecution') | Asserts rigid privilege constraints |
getConfig(path, fallback) | ctx.getConfig('plugins.io.github.demo.timeoutMs', 5000) | Queries read-only Configuration |
setRuntimeData(key, value) | ctx.setRuntimeData('init_stamp', Date.now()) | Allocates short-cycle Plugin states |
getRuntimeData(key) | ctx.getRuntimeData<number>('init_stamp') | Resolves short-cycle Plugin states |
PluginLifecycleContext Static Attributes
pluginIdpluginRootconfigstate
Resolution Protocol:
const targetId = ctx.pluginId;
const rootDir = ctx.pluginRoot;
const activeState = ctx.state;Reference Implementation Model: MVP Architecture
Executing strict fluent composition mapping:
import { createExtension } from '@jshookmcp/extension-sdk';
export default createExtension('io.github.demo.plugin', '0.1.0')
.compatibleCore('^0.1.0')
.allowTool(['page_navigate'])
.metric(['demo.loaded'])
.onLoad((ctx) => {
ctx.setRuntimeData('init_success', true);
})
.onActivate(async (ctx) => {
ctx.registerMetric('demo.loaded');
await ctx.invokeTool('page_navigate', { url: 'https://example.com' });
});Workflow SDK Capabilities
@jshookmcp/extension-sdk/workflow Export Hierarchy
Interfaces and Structural Types
RetryPolicyWorkflowNodeTypeToolNodeSequenceNodeParallelNodeBranchNodeWorkflowNodeWorkflowExecutionContextWorkflowContractToolNodeOptions
Actionable Top-Level Generators (4)
| Functional Signature | Minimal Integration Syntax | Architectural Purpose |
|---|---|---|
toolNode(id, toolName, options?) | toolNode('nav', 'page_navigate', { input: { url: 'https://example.com' } }) | Declares atomic capability execution triggers |
sequenceNode(id, steps) | sequenceNode('main', [stepA, stepB]) | Models sequential dependency constraints |
parallelNode(id, steps, maxConcurrency?, failFast?) | parallelNode('collect', [graphA, graphB], 2, false) | Generates un-ordered parallel batch vectors |
branchNode(id, predicateId, whenTrue, whenFalse?, predicateFn?) | branchNode('gate', 'hasAuth', trueBranch, falseBranch) | Allocates conditional logic pipelines |
WorkflowExecutionContext Injected Execution Vectors (4)
| Execution Vector | Implementation Signature | Contract Adherence |
|---|---|---|
invokeTool(toolName, args) | await ctx.invokeTool('network_get_requests', {}) | Invokes specific Node side-effects |
emitSpan(name, attrs?) | ctx.emitSpan('trace.start', { segment: 'init' }) | Emits distinct execution track elements |
emitMetric(name, value, type, attrs?) | ctx.emitMetric('probe.count', 1, 'counter') | Maps specific telemetry parameters |
getConfig(path, fallback) | ctx.getConfig('workflows.capture.trace', true) | Evaluates Workflow-bound mappings |
WorkflowExecutionContext Static Attributes
workflowRunIdprofile
Resolution Protocol:
const executeId = ctx.workflowRunId;
const profileConfig = ctx.profile;Reference Implementation Model: Protocol Graph
import type { WorkflowContract, WorkflowExecutionContext } from '@jshookmcp/extension-sdk/workflow';
import { toolNode, sequenceNode } from '@jshookmcp/extension-sdk/workflow';
export const workflow: WorkflowContract = {
kind: 'workflow-contract',
version: 1,
id: 'demo.capture',
displayName: 'Telemetry Synthesis',
build(_ctx: WorkflowExecutionContext) {
return sequenceNode('core_sequence', [
toolNode('navigate', 'page_navigate', {
input: { url: 'https://example.com' },
}),
toolNode('links', 'page_get_all_links'),
]);
},
};
export default workflow;Process Abstraction Bridges SDK
Sourced via @jshookmcp/extension-sdk/bridges.
Core Mapping Exports
| Interface Class | Evaluation Scope |
|---|---|
JsonObject | Normalization alias bridging Record<string, unknown> |
TextToolResponse | Canonical Text standard format implementation response |
ProcessRunResult | Execution dump matrix mapping exitCode, standard Output, and standard Error |
HttpJsonResult | Endpoint response container abstracting status, JSON output, and text dump |
Implementation Top-Level Helpers (11)
| Invocation Call | Concrete Implementation Reference | Objective Map |
|---|---|---|
toTextResponse(payload) | return toTextResponse({ success: true }) | Encapsulates payload under uniform Text MCP response |
toErrorResponse(tool, error, extra?) | return toErrorResponse('diagnostic_tool', err) | Encapsulates stack errors underneath uniform schema |
parseStringArg(args, key, required?) | const url = parseStringArg(args, 'url', true) | Filters bounded variables explicitly defining typed parameters |
toDisplayPath(absolutePath) | toDisplayPath('D:/workspace/stream.txt') | Formats path pointers mapping standardized rendering variants |
resolveOutputDirectory(toolName, target, requestedDir?) | await resolveOutputDirectory('diagnostic', 'local.host') | Allocates local I/O directory outputs |
checkExternalCommand(command, versionArgs, label, installHint?) | await checkExternalCommand('python', ['-V'], 'python') | Synthesizes pre-flight assertions for host-derived CLI links |
runProcess(command, args, options?) | await runProcess('node', ['-v']) | Orchestrates and limits spawned host sub-process pipelines |
assertLoopbackUrl(value, label?) | assertLoopbackUrl('http://127.0.0.1:9222') | Subjugates network streams exclusively across local interfaces |
normalizeBaseUrl(value) | normalizeBaseUrl('http://127.0.0.1:9222/api') | Canonical URL string unification process |
buildUrl(baseUrl, path, query?) | buildUrl('http://127.0.0.1:9222', '/json/list') | Protocol standard path assembler |
requestJson(url, method?, bodyObj?, timeoutMs?) | await requestJson('http://127.0.0.1:9222/json/version') | High-speed JSON retrieval interface |
Abstracted Invocation Topology
import {
assertLoopbackUrl,
buildUrl,
requestJson,
toTextResponse,
} from '@jshookmcp/extension-sdk/bridges';
const endpoint = assertLoopbackUrl('http://127.0.0.1:9222');
const fetchUrl = buildUrl(endpoint, '/json/version');
const payloadInfo = await requestJson(fetchUrl);
return toTextResponse({
success: true,
status: payloadInfo.status,
data: payloadInfo.data,
});Canonical Operational Sub-routines

return toTextResponse({ success: true, data: executionRes.data });Firm Architecture Enforcement Constraints
invokeTool()resolves strictly alongside internal primitive capability APIs.- Operability demands synchronization intersecting explicitly defined capability grants (
permissions) alongside global tier profiles (ToolProfile). Workflowparadigms govern graph tree compositions; raw browser DOM instances remain isolated from direct AST node tampering.configDefaultsguarantees non-destructive hydration against null-values without overriding pre-established attributes.loadPluginEnv()confines mutations within the module schema avoiding process-levelprocess.envdegradation.
